Analysis

The most recent figure for prevalence of diarrhea (% of children under 5): q2 in Zimbabwe is 13.3%, measured in 2019.

The figure is up 11.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, prevalence of diarrhea (% of children under 5): q2 in Zimbabwe peaked at 23.5% in 1994 and was at its lowest, 11.9%, in 2009.

Zimbabwe ranks 28th of 40 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

Prevalence of diarrhea (% of children under 5): Q2 in Zimbabwe, year by year

Annual values for Prevalence of diarrhea (% of children under 5): Q2 in Zimbabwe, 1994 to 2019.
Year Value Change
1994 23.5%
1999 18.4% -21.7%
2006 17.4% -5.4%
2009 11.9% -31.6%
2011 17.2% +44.5%
2014 16.1% -6.4%
2015 21.9% +36.0%
2019 13.3% -39.3%
